    Common Problems and Issues

    While the Kia Optima 1.7 CRDi is generally a reliable car, like any vehicle, it's not without its potential problems and issues. Some owners have reported issues with the diesel particulate filter (DPF), which can become clogged over time, especially if the car is primarily used for short trips. A clogged DPF can lead to reduced engine performance, increased fuel consumption, and potentially expensive repairs. Regular highway driving can help to prevent DPF issues by allowing the filter to regenerate properly.

    Other common problems reported by owners include issues with the automatic transmission, such as hesitation or jerky shifts. These issues can sometimes be resolved with a software update or fluid change, but in more severe cases, the transmission may require more extensive repairs. It's essential to address any transmission issues promptly to prevent further damage.

    Additionally, some owners have experienced problems with the electrical system, such as faulty sensors or malfunctioning accessories. These issues can be frustrating and difficult to diagnose, but a qualified mechanic can typically resolve them. Regular maintenance and inspections can help to identify and prevent potential electrical problems.
